Subject: Key rotation for Tilevault cache

Hi all — quick heads-up that we rotated the credentials for Tilevault, the tile-rendering cache layer, after last week's audit flagged the old key's age. Old key dies Friday. Please confirm the new one is scoped correctly before we ship. For your review, the replacement is below.

API key for yahig-tadup: kto7_ubizbYm

### RateLens API

Quick note for the sync: RateLens, our hotel rate-parity checker, now exposes a `/discrepancies` endpoint that returns mismatched rates per property. Auth is just a header key against the internal ParitySvc gateway — no token dance needed. Rate limits are generous for internal callers. For demos this week, use the shared key below.

service key, tadup-tahog: zpat7_wB1tnEL

Runbook: Scanline barcode bridge

If warehouse scans stop flowing into Cartwheel, it's almost always the bridge service on the Dunmore floor box wedging after a USB hiccup. Bounce the service first — nine times out of ten that fixes it. If not, check the queue depth before escalating. When restarting, make sure the bridge comes up with these settings.

deployment values, yafop-bajef:
[gilok]
team = ulaius
access_code = ac_423664
host = gilok.sivrelhq.corp
port = 9200
owner = pelius.istax
peer = eliok.torvasoft.internal

Welcome aboard, Tessa. The margin review for Corlan Fabrications is halfway done. We've reconciled Q2 input costs across the Delmere and Ashvale plants; the remaining work is allocating freight overheads to the Vantrex product line, which has distorted reported margins by roughly two points. Piet in costing has the working files and will walk you through the methodology. Flag anything above a one-point swing to the audit committee. The confidential outline of where we intend to take pricing next is set out below.

confidential, fajop-fajef: Soriusax Foods plans to lower the Rusix list price by 43.2 percent in December. The steering committee signed off on a budget of $74.0 million for Project Oliion. The renewal with Brivanix Works closes at $118.6 million a year, 43.4 percent above the last contract. Project Ulaiel slips by six weeks because of the audit delay.